The ADXL321 is a small and thin, low power, complete dual-axis accelerometer with signal conditioned voltage outputs, which is all on a single monolithic IC. The product measures acceleration with a full-scale range of ±18 g typical). It can also measure both dynamic acceleration (vibration) and static acceleration (gravity).
The ADXL321's typical noise floor is 320 g/Hz, allowing signals below 3 mg to be resolved in tilt-sensing applications using narrow bandwidths (<50 Hz).
The user selects the bandwidth of the accelerometer using capacitors CX and CY at the XOUT and YOUT pins. Bandwidths of 0.5 Hz to 2.5 kHz may be selected to suit the application.
The ADXL321 is available in a very thin 4 mm * 4 mm * 1.45 mm, 16-lead, plastic LFCSP.

Stresses above those listed under Absolute Maximum Ratings may cause permanent damage to the device. This is a stress rating only; functional operation of the device at these or any other conditions above those indicated in the operational section of this specification is not implied. Exposure to absolute maximum rating conditions for extended periods may affect device reliability.
ADXL321 Features
` Small and thin 4 mm * 4 mm * 1.45 mm LFCSP package ` 3 mg resolution at 50 Hz ` Wide supply voltage range: 2.4 V to 6 V ` Low power: 350 A at VS = 2.4 V (typ) ` Good zero g bias stability ` Good sensitivity accuracy ` X-axis and Y-axis aligned to within 0.1° (typ) ` BW adjustment with a single capacitor ` Single-supply operation ` 10,000 g shock survival ` Compatible with Sn/Pb and Pb-free solder processes
